Migration
Creating a New Migration
To create a new migration file:
make migration <migration_name>
Replace <migration_name>
with a descriptive name for your migration.
Applying Migrations
To apply migrations:
Up (Apply migrations):
make migrate-up
Down (Rollback migrations):
make migrate-down
Code Generation
Generating CRUD Code
Define the schema in schemas/schema.go
file.
To generate CRUD code for a specific schema, specify SCHEMA_NAME
:
make codegen crud SCHEMA_NAME=your_schema_name
Replace your_schema_name
with the name of the schema defined in your schemas package.
Running the Application
Build and Run To build and run the application:
make run
This command will compile the project and execute the generated executable.
Cleaning Up
Clean Built Binaries To clean up built binaries:
make clean
This command will delete the bin directory.
